    The first row of K1 P1, you knitted the front loop. The next row, yourknit was in the back loop. Why tge difference?

    • @CrazyHandsKnitting
      @CrazyHandsKnitting  2 ปีที่แล้ว +2

      Please knit as you usually knit. If you are doing it through the front loop, go on doing it after as well. I use continental way of knitting and grabbing the yarn a little bit differently, that is why after I knit through the back loops.
